MASCOT evaluates the cell quality by three factors, i.e. the number of genes detected (default 500), the number of unique molecular identifier induced (default 1500), and the percentage of mitochondrial genes detected (default 10% among all the detected genes). Only cells with the first two factors above the thresholds and the third factor below the threshold are retained.

expression_profile |
A dataframe showing the expression profile. |
sample_info_gene |
A character vector showing the knockout gene of each sample. The vector's column name is the sample name. |
species |
The species the cells belong to. Currently species="Hs" for homo sapiens or species="Mm" for mus musculus are available. |
gene_low |
The minimun gene number for cells. Cells with genes below this threshold are filtered(default 500). |
gene_high |
The maximum gene number for cells. cells with genes above this threshold are filtered(default 10000). |
mito_high |
The maximum percentage of mitochondrial genes detected(default 10% among all the detected genes). |
umi_low |
The minimum number of unique molecular identifier induced (default 1500). |
umi_high |
The maximun number of unique molecular identifier induced (default Inf) |
plot |
FALSE by default. If TURE, plot the graph. |
plot_path |
The path of the graph you plot. It works only when the parameter "plot" is TRUE. |
expression_profile_qc |
A dataframe showing expression profile after quality control. |
sample_info_gene_qc |
A character vector showing the knockout gene of each sample after quality control. |
